Thakazhi Literary Award is an annual Malayalam literary award that recognises a writer's overall contribution to Malayalam literature. 

The Thakazhi Memorial Committee, which works under the Alappuzha Culture Department, established the prize in 2014 to honour Thakazhi Sivasankara Pillai, the Storyteller of Kuttanad (കുട്ടനാടിന്റെ കഥാകാരൻ)

The award carries a monetary award of ₹50000 and a citation. 

The First Recipient of this award was Prof. G. Balachandran in 2014 for his work Thakazhiyude SargapadangalAll subsequent prizes except the first award are granted for overall contributions to Malayalam literature.

The Last Recipient of Thakazhi Literary Award in 2023 is M.K. Sanu.

The prize is normally given out during the Literary Festival held on April 17th to mark Thakazhi Sivasankara Pillai's birthday.


List of Thakazhi Literary Award Recipients:


YearRecipient
2014Prof. G. Balachandran
2015M.T. Vasudevan Nair
2016C. Radhakrishnan
2018T. Padmanabhan
2019Sreekumaran Thampi
2020Perumpadavam Sreedharan
2021M. Leelavathi
2022M. Mukundan
2023M.K. Sanu


Thakazhi Sivasankara Pillai

  • The first person to win JnanpithEzhutachchan award and Vallathol award – Thakazhi Sivasankara Pillai.
  •  Epithets – Kerala Mopassang, Kuttanadinte Kathakaran, Kuttanadinte Ithihasakaran.
  • The first novel of Thakazhi – Thyaagathinu Prathifalam (ത്യാഗത്തിനു പ്രതിഫലം, 1934).
  • Author of the Malayalam Novel "Chemmeen" – Thakazhi Sivasankara Pillai (1956).
  • The backdrop of the Novel "Chemmeen" was set on – Purakkad beach, Alappuzha.
  • The film that won the President's Golden Lotus for the first time in South India – Chemmeen (Ramu Kariat, 1965).
  • The backdrop for the film "Chemmeen" was shot on – Nattika Beach, Thrissur.
  • Autobiographies – Ormayude Theerangalil, Ente Balyakalakatha, Ente Vakeel Jeevitham.
